Output 81e9962c404db9e142c3ef89fc95748c50cef9110df2ed8a39217d237a2b3332:0

value
8572536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6530da2fd38169039f13e725106064f1a738e068 OP_EQUAL
address
3Av4hEc8vEeiULHht4c3GuRgFwhmR59ePN
transaction
81e9962c404db9e142c3ef89fc95748c50cef9110df2ed8a39217d237a2b3332
confirmations
333449
spent
true